During the winter shutdown (24 December to 2 January), Marlowe House operates reduced hours. Main reception at the Corven Street entrance is staffed 08:00–14:00 on working days only; the Ashgate Lane side door is locked throughout. Visiting contractors must sign in at reception and be escorted to the loading bay by a Ferndale Logistics supervisor. Out-of-hours deliveries are not accepted during this period. If you arrive before reception opens, use the contractor door beside Bay 2 with the following pass code.

turnstile pass: bdg-FVNQRS-72965873

**Ticket SITE-1187: Incremental rebuilds skipping changed markdown**

On Pagewright's staging cluster, incremental rebuilds of the Fennick docs site skip pages whose only change is frontmatter. Full rebuilds render correctly, so the dependency graph is dropping frontmatter edges. Reproduced three times tonight. On-call: please bisect against the rebuild daemon whose build token appears below.

build token for tahop-fafof: htk14_2d55df8101eccc

### Alert: SproutCycle missed watering window

This fires when SproutCycle skips a scheduled watering run for any zone. Usually it's a stuck zone lock or the valve controller napping after a restart. Plants survive one miss; two in a row and things get crispy. Remediation steps and lock-clearing commands are documented on the internal page below.

wiki page, bawef-hafop: https://jira.nelvroworks.corp/job/pages/projects/7c5c0f440dbd